> The Kernel is plain uncompressed ELF "vmlinux".
> I didn't succeed with the build on the Netstation itself. However, I am
> currently cross-compiling the 2.4.29. - Then I'll try compressed images
> as well.
>
> For reasons I don't understand I cannot loopmount the
> initrd-ppc-2.4.22-ltsp-1 from your archives. I wanted to throw out all
> the modules to get it smaller, since the size of the netboot-image the
> NS1000 accepts seems somehow limited.
>
> In the meantime my cross-compilation hang up. [EMAIL PROTECTED]
>
> powerpc-linux-gcc -D__ASSEMBLY__ -D__KERNEL__
> -I/res/sarge-ppc/usr/src/linux-2.4.29/include
> -I/res/sarge-ppc/usr/src/linux-2.4.29/arch/ppc   -c -o cpu_setup_6xx.o
> cpu_setup_6xx.S
> cpu_setup_6xx.S: Assembler messages:
> cpu_setup_6xx.S:444: Error: Unrecognized opcode: `mftbl'
> cpu_setup_6xx.S:445: Error: Unrecognized opcode: `mftbl'
> make[1]: *** [cpu_setup_6xx.o] Fehler 1
> make[1]: Leaving directory
> `/res/sarge-ppc/usr/src/linux-2.4.29/arch/ppc/kernel'
> make: *** [_dir_arch/ppc/kernel] Error 2
>
> ...does that mean anything to you?
